The Moraine City Council made significant strides in governance during its regular meeting on June 26, 2025, particularly with the approval of key ordinances and resolutions that will impact local operations and community safety.
One of the standout decisions was the unanimous approval of a resolution authorizing the city manager to enter into a memorandum of understanding with the West Carrollton City School District. This agreement will ensure the provision of a school resource officer (SRO) for the upcoming 2025-2026 school year, reinforcing the city’s commitment to enhancing safety in schools. Mayor Murphy emphasized the importance of this partnership, stating, "This agreement is vital for maintaining a secure environment for our students."
Additionally, the council approved a resolution for membership in the National League of Cities, which will cost the city $1,314 in annual dues for 2025-2026. This membership is expected to provide valuable resources and networking opportunities for city officials.
The council also addressed infrastructure needs by awarding the 2025 crack sealing program to Buck Pavement Restoration LLC for $69,600. This initiative aims to maintain and improve local road conditions, a crucial aspect of community safety and accessibility.
In other discussions, the council reviewed amendments to the merit system commission rules and regulations, ensuring that local governance remains up-to-date and effective.
